Mechanical Keys

The classic mechanical key is a basic physical device that connects to the lock cylinders of the car's ignition as well as door locks. They aren't electronic and can only be cut with an ordinary key cutter or locksmith's tool. These type of keys are commonly found in older vehicles as well as certain foreign models. These keys are also less expensive than other kinds of keys for cars and key fobs.

To duplicate a car-key mechanically, the original key is placed in a key duplication machine along with the blank. This allows the machine to trace the key's original shape onto the blank, which then cuts the key into a new shape. This is the same method that locksmiths employ to create keys for opening a home, office or safe. The key created is ready to be put into your vehicle.

Transponder Keys

You can be certain that your vehicle is equipped with a transponder the event that it was made within the last few years. These tiny chips emit a signal that your vehicle is programmed to recognise and know when someone is trying to start it. Then, it turns off the engine to prevent theft.

There are several types of transponder keys. They could be traditional blade-style that need to be put into the ignition, or they can be incorporated into a key fob that is kept in your purse or pocket. In either case, they all require programming to work with your vehicle.

The most common type of transponder car key is known as a sidewinder key because of the ridges that are cut into the blade. This innovative blade design was introduced to the automotive industry in the 1990s, and soon became a standard security feature in a variety of popular automobiles. Today, you'll find these high-security keys in every car that comes off the dealership lot.

Smart Keys

Smart keys take the concept of car remote control technology to a whole new level. Smart keys come with a chip that is recognized by the antennas of your vehicle. It lets you unlock your doors and start your engine without having to remove it from your purse or pocket. It also provides a range of other functions, such as the ability to save settings for different drivers as well as remotely open the windows and sunroof.

Smart Keys are equipped with an inbuilt feature that stops your car from starting or turning on if you lock the key inside the trunk or cabin. This feature is designed to prevent the possibility of locking your car in a secluded area where an intruder could easily swindle you by watching you struggle to open the keys.

A smart key has another safety feature built-in: it won't function if the battery dies. This will prevent you from being trapped in a dangerous intersection or in a risky location. Most smart key systems will warn you when the battery is running low, but the way they do this differs from system-to-system.

Smart keys can be programmed to alter various vehicle settings depending on the key used to unlock the vehicle. Seat positions, mirror adjustments and the climate control settings are some of the most popular examples of these changes. Certain models allow parents to set speed limits if the key used to start the vehicle. This can help prevent teens from driving too fast.

Laser Keys

The laser key adds another layer of security to your vehicle. The keys are created with a unique code that matches with the pins in your lock's cylinder. The key's steel is shaped to match the patterns of these pins, which allows it to push through them and open the door of your car.

Laser-cut keys are a complete departure from traditional keys produced by mechanical machines. Laser-cut keys do not have a series or notches along the edges, but instead a winding groove that runs down the center. This unique shape makes them appear different from traditional keys and it's also what makes them the name 'sidewinder' keys.

You'll only find them in newer cars because they're a lot more difficult to duplicate. This is because they require a very expensive and high-quality piece of equipment to produce them, which makes it almost impossible for a thief to duplicate a laser-cut key without the assistance of your local locksmith.

Additionally, they are difficult to duplicate, keys made of lasers can be used in conjunction with transponder chips for additional security. Transponder chips are unique to each car, and the key's code must be matched to the transponder's code to start the engine of your car. Without a matching key the car will not start - even if have the right physical key.
